Benjamin Moore

Antique White

909 / OC-83, PM-22

Antique White is a warm off-white with a distinct peach undertone that separates it from cooler or strictly yellow-based whites. With an LRV of 77.8, it reflects substantial light and reads bright on walls while carrying enough color to distinguish it from a clean white. The peach cast becomes more apparent under warm artificial lighting and recedes under strong daylight.

White Dove and Cloud White serve as compatible trim options, while Kendall Charcoal or Hale Navy define accent features. Manchester Tan offers a slightly deeper warm neutral for adjoining rooms.
